KG DongbuSteel Co Ltd

Iron & SteelVerified

KG DongbuSteel maintains a market price of 6,950 KRW per share, with a market capitalization of 672.64 billion KRW. The company's price-to-earnings ratio is 4.98, and its price-to-book ratio is 0.33, indicating a relatively low valuation compared to book value. The company's liquidity position is characterized by a current ratio of 1.21, suggesting moderate liquidity. The company's debt-to-equity ratio is 0.3, indicating a relatively conservative capital structure. In terms of profitability, KG DongbuSteel has a return on equity of 6.57% and a return on assets of 4.36%. These figures are below the industry median for return on equity and return on assets, suggesting that the company is underperforming its peers in terms of profitability. The company's operating margin is 4.83%, and its net profit margin is 4.23%, which are also below the industry median. KG DongbuSteel's revenue is primarily concentrated in South Korea, with no significant international exposure reported in the financial data. The company's revenue concentration in a single geographic region may expose it to local economic and regulatory risks. The company's revenue growth trajectory is positive, with a current fiscal year outlook indicating a potential increase in revenue. The company's capital expenditure is -63.31 billion KRW, indicating a reduction in investment in new projects or facilities. This may suggest a focus on maintaining existing operations rather than expanding. KG DongbuSteel faces a medium liquidity risk, as indicated by the risk assessment. The company's liquidity position is further complicated by the fact that net cash is negative after subtracting total debt. The company's dilution risk is low, suggesting that there is minimal threat to shareholder value from new share issuances. Recent events, including analyst estimates, indicate a strong buy recommendation with a mean price target of 8,000 KRW. This suggests that analysts have a positive outlook on the company's future performance.
